Pokerstars thrives in New Jersey

April 5, 2016

Cash game traffic numbers from New Jersey show that the second week of Pokerstars operations in the Garden State has again yielding encouraging results, with the online poker giant maintaining its lead in the dedicated market and averaging 160 ring game players a day according to statistics from the Pokerscout independent online poker monitor. Pokerstars announces earlier debut in New Jersey

March 10, 2016

Pokerstars has announced a change to its formal launch date in New Jersey of March 21, revealing that it will soft-launch in the Garden State next week on March 16. New Jersey regulator mulls use of celebrities in online poker

December 5, 2015

The New Jersey Division of Gaming Enforcement announced Thursday that it is considering a celebrity-based promotional scheme as a means of improving business for the online operators licensed in the state.
